Description
TGA2567-SM 2-20 GHz LNA Amplifier Applications      General Purpose LNA/Gain Block Point to Point Radio Electronic Warfare Military & Commercial Radar Communications QFN 4x4mm 24L Product Features         Frequency Range: 2 – 20 GHz PSAT : 22 dBm P1dB : 19 dBm Small Signal Gain: 17 dB Adjustable Gain Range Output TOI: 29 dBm Noise Figure: 2 dB Bias: VD = 5 V, IDQ = 100 mA, VG1 = -0.7 V, VG2 = +1.3 V Typical  ESD Protection Circuitry on VD , VG1 and VG2  Package Dimensions: 4.0 x 4.0 x 1.42 mm Functional Block Diagram General Description TriQuint’s TGA2567-SM is a LNA Gain Block fabricated on TriQuint’s proven 0.15um pHEMT production process. The TGA2567-SM operates from 2 to 20 GHz and typically provides 19 dBm of 1dB compressed output power with 17 dB of small signal gain. Greater than 16 dB of adjustable gain can be achieved by varying VG2. The Noise Figure is typically 2 dB at mid band The TGA2567-SM is available in a low-cost, surface mount 24 lead 4x4 AIN QFN package base with an Air cavity LCP lid. TGA2567-SM is ideally suited to support both commercial and defense related applications. Lead-free and RoHS compliant. Evaluation Boards are available upon request.
